Output 3c836f6c7be9a8f45838334361275a83ff557e343554780e2c5e61ac66c571b4:2

value
17425188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9887bfa1d7e50f933faeaedca07229c09f482b2b OP_EQUAL
address
3FbXFgFPdVHddR6n9TLjohytLoWhkriBc3
transaction
3c836f6c7be9a8f45838334361275a83ff557e343554780e2c5e61ac66c571b4
spent
true